If the mass of a material is 49 grams and the volume of the material is 7 cm^3, what would the density of the material be?
inysia [295]
The equation for density is:
density =  \frac{mass}{volume}

To help you remember - my teacher told us to remember "We <span>♡ density," and the heart stands for </span>\frac{m}{v}, or \frac{mass}{volume}. Cheesy, but it works!<span>
</span>
Back to the problem:
We know the mass if 49g and the volume is 7 cm^{3}, so plug these values into the equation for density:
density = \frac{mass}{volume}\\&#10;density = \frac{49\:g}{7\:cm^{3}} \\&#10;density = 7\:g/cm^{3}

Answer: The density is 7 g/cm^{3}

One card is drawn from a well shuffled deck of 52 cards find the probability of getting a red 10
Julli [10]
The probability of getting a red card is 1/2 and the probability of getting a 10 is 4/52. To find the probability of getting both a red card and a 10, multiply the two.

(1/2)(4/52) = 4/104
4/104 = 1/26

Therefore, the probability is 1/26
